Google has launched its latest image-generation model, Nano Banana Pro, marking another stride in the rapidly evolving field of artificial intelligence. This new model promises enhanced capabilities and improved performance compared to its predecessors, solidifying Google’s position as a leader in AI research and development. Nano Banana Pro aims to provide users with more realistic, detailed, and customizable images, catering to a wide range of applications from creative design to scientific visualization.
Key Features and Improvements
Nano Banana Pro boasts several key features that set it apart from previous image-generation models. One of the most notable improvements is its ability to generate images with greater resolution and clarity. This allows for finer details and more realistic textures, making the generated images suitable for professional use. Additionally, the model incorporates advanced algorithms that enable it to better understand and interpret user prompts, resulting in images that more closely align with the user’s vision. The model is also trained on a larger and more diverse dataset, which enhances its ability to generate a wider variety of images, including complex scenes and abstract concepts.
Another significant advancement is the model’s enhanced control over image attributes. Users can now fine-tune various aspects of the generated images, such as color palettes, lighting conditions, and artistic styles. This level of customization provides users with greater creative freedom and allows them to tailor the images to their specific needs. Furthermore, Nano Banana Pro incorporates improved safety mechanisms to prevent the generation of inappropriate or harmful content, addressing a critical concern in the development of AI-powered image generation tools.
Applications and Impact
The potential applications of Nano Banana Pro are vast and diverse. In the creative industry, it can be used by designers and artists to generate concept art, prototypes, and marketing materials. In scientific research, it can aid in visualizing complex data and creating simulations. The model also has potential applications in education, entertainment, and various other fields. The release of Nano Banana Pro is expected to have a significant impact on the AI landscape, driving further innovation and competition in the development of image-generation technologies. As AI continues to advance, models like Nano Banana Pro will play an increasingly important role in shaping the future of digital content creation and visual communication.
